Satellite wind study

Unlock the full potential of your site with GEVI’s satellite-based anemometric reports. By analyzing the past 10 years of wind data, we provide a clear picture of the average wind conditions in any location — helping you anticipate the energy returns of your investment.

Our reports deliver monthly insights on:
• Wind speed trends
• Predominant wind directions
• Wind speed distribution

When paired with the GEVI turbine power curve, this analysis transforms into a powerful forecast of your site’s expected energy production, making project decisions smarter, faster, and more reliable.

GEVI Patented Anemometer

Experience wind like never before with the GEVI patented anemometer — the world’s first wind sensor with no moving parts. Compact, lightweight, and robust, it redefines on-site wind measurement.

Ultra-compact design

Only 15 cm tall, 5 cm in diameter, weighing less than 1 kg

High-precision monitoring

High-precision monitoring: real-time measurement of wind speed and direction at your specific site — rooftops, open fields, or industrial grounds

Unique insights

captures local wind dynamics beyond the reach of satellite data

Long-term accuracy

deployed on-site for 3–6 months to build a full-year wind profile through advanced interpolation

Always connected

data available in real time, whenever you need it

With the GEVI anemometer, you gain unparalleled visibility into your site’s wind potential — the essential first step toward maximizing your energy productivity.
